Default Word 2003 Booklet printing on wrong pages and not all pages

I have been printing our church bulletins (a 4 page booklet) for many years
on the same computer (XP). Now, only 1-page of the booklet prints and it is
on the right-side of the landscape document. None of the other pages print.
I've tried printing old booklet documents and creating one from scratch and
the condition continues. Any help would be appreciated.

Word's "Book fold" feature has never been very reliable. For a four-pager,
I'd suggest this solution instead:

1. Change the "Multiple pages" setting from "Book fold" to "2 pages per
sheet." This will not change your layout at all.

2. Print the doc by putting "2,3,4,1" (or "4,1,2,3") in the "Pages" box
(assuming duplexing). If you're printing just one side at a time, you'll
know what to do.
